Interestingly, our data recommended that actinobacteria are active oestrogen degraders inside the urban estuarine sediment.Summary Steroidal oestrogens are generally accumulated in urban estuarine sediments worldwide at microgram per gram levels. These aromatic steroids have already been classified as endocrine disruptors and group 1 carcinogens. Microbial degradation is really a naturally occurring mechanism that mineralizes oestrogens within the biosphere; having said that, the corresponding genes in oestrogen-degrading actinobacteria stay unidentified. Within this study, we identified a gene cluster encoding a number of putative oestrogen-degrading genes (aed; actinobacterial oestrogen degradation) in actinobacterium Rhodococcus sp. strain B50. Among them, the aedA and aedB genes involved in oestrogenic A-ring cleavage have been identified by way of gene-disruption experiments. All-natural oestrogens include oestrone (E1), 17b-oestradiol (E2) and oestriol (E3). The synthesis and secretion of oestrogens exclusively occur in animals, particularly in vertebrates (Matsumoto et al., 1997; Tarrant et al., 2003). Within the animal liver, oestrogens undergo structural modifications (e.g., glucuronidation) and are converted into additional soluble metabolites to become excreted by means of urine and faeces (Harvey and Farrier, 2011). While needed by animals, chronic exposure to trace oestrogens at sub-nanomolar levels can disrupt the endocrine system and sexual improvement in animals (Belfroid et al., 1999; Baronti et al., 2000; Huang and Sedlak, 2001; Kolodziej et al., 2003; Lee et al., 2006). As an example, an E2 concentration of 54 ng l brought on extreme abnormal improvement amongst eelpout embryos (Morthorst et al., 2014). Similarly, the EC50 of E2 causing infertility of fathead minnows (Pimephales promelas) was 120 ng l (Kramer et al., 1998).
